Skip to content

Commit

Permalink
proper latency check
Browse files Browse the repository at this point in the history
  • Loading branch information
openint-bot committed Feb 27, 2025
1 parent 14f5cd2 commit 759a916
Showing 1 changed file with 4 additions and 2 deletions.
6 changes: 4 additions & 2 deletions packages-v1/api-v1/app.ts
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import {swagger} from '@elysiajs/swagger'
import {Elysia} from 'elysia'
import type {Database} from '@openint/db-v1'
import {createDatabase} from '@openint/db-v1'
import {createDatabase, createNeonDatabase} from '@openint/db-v1'
import {envRequired} from '@openint/env'
import {createOpenApiHandler, createTrpcHandler} from './trpc/handlers'
import {generateOpenAPISpec} from './trpc/openapi'
Expand All @@ -19,7 +19,9 @@ export const app = new Elysia({prefix: '/api'})
createDatabase({url: envRequired.DATABASE_URL}),
)
const neonLatencyMs = await checkLatency(
createDatabase({url: envRequired.DATABASE_URL}),
createNeonDatabase({
url: envRequired.DATABASE_URL,
}) as unknown as Database,
)
return {healthy: true, postgresJsLatencyMs, neonLatencyMs}
})
Expand Down

0 comments on commit 759a916

Please sign in to comment.